Oh man, you absolutely should not be hurting for work right now. If you have any marketing aptitude, you can sell yourself and pitch the necessity of having an e-presence to cater to the youth. And if you're willing to sell your soul and go to Republican meet-ups (I certainly was), even Illinois' 13th seat which historically goes 80/13 and is basically a lock will spend 30k in petty cash right now if you can demonstrate experience with CRM conversions (i.e., think: donor dbs-- you can easily bill 250/hr if you're Salesforce certified). DC is glorious for engineers during uncertain election years especially for congressmen who are naturally always in fundraising mode, I used to clean up even during mid-terms. I don't bother with cold-calling ever but everyone's accessible now. Get penned for 15 minutes with campaign managers for congressmen and whoever's running their "social media outreach" component for senators (those fish are harder to catch, your return-on-time-investment is going to be best spent targeting vulnerable congressmen).
